Nintendo Switch 2 officially debuts

Nintendo has finally taken the lid off the successor to the ever popular Nintendo Switch. The long awaited next generation console will be properly named the Switch 2 and will continue the portability that the original Switch popularized starting back in 2017.

At nearly 8 years of shelf life, the Nintendo Switch has long overstayed its competitveness in many categories of gaming, but especially in graphical and frame rate performance. 

We don’t have all the details yet about the power of the Switch 2, but we do know that the new device will be released sometime in 2025 and it will largely keep the same format as the original console. The Switch 2 will be larger, feature magnetic Joy-Cons, a wider horizontal kickstand that fills the entire length of the body, and an additional USB-C port. In the trailer video, Nintendo also teased a brand new Mario Kart game.

The gaming market for portable consoles has evolved greatly since the original Switch launched nearly a decade ago. Will Nintendo be able to maintain its stronghold and continue the gold standard? Only time will tell as we get closer to the launch date.
